Choosing the right career path is one of the most significant decisions we make in life. It’s a journey of self-discovery, exploration, and aligning our passions with our professional pursuits. While it can feel daunting and overwhelming at times, with the right approach and mindset, we can uncover our true passions and find a career that brings us joy, fulfillment, and a sense of purpose. Here are some valuable tips to help you navigate the process and discover your true career calling.
Reflect on Your Passions and Interests: Start by taking time to reflect on your passions and interests. What activities make you come alive? What subjects or hobbies do you find yourself deeply engrossed in? Identify the areas that ignite a spark within you, as they often hold clues to your true calling. Think about your childhood dreams, the activities that bring you joy, and the topics you enjoy learning about. This introspective process will help you gain insights into the areas of work that align with your natural inclinations.
Assess Your Skills and Strengths: Next, assess your skills and strengths. What are you naturally good at? What abilities do you possess that can be valuable in a professional setting? Consider your strengths in areas such as communication, problem-solving, creativity, organization, and leadership. Understanding your skills and strengths will help you identify career paths where you can leverage and further develop these qualities.
Explore Different Industries and Professions: Take the time to explore different industries and professions. Research various career options and learn about the skills, qualifications, and responsibilities associated with each. Attend industry events, informational interviews, and networking opportunities to gain firsthand knowledge and insights. Seek out mentors and professionals in fields that interest you to learn about their experiences and get a sense of the day-to-day realities of their work. By exploring a wide range of options, you can gain a better understanding of what resonates with you and aligns with your passions.
Try New Experiences and Volunteer: Sometimes, the best way to discover your passion is by trying new experiences and volunteering in different fields. Engage in internships, part-time jobs, or volunteer work related to your areas of interest. This hands-on experience will provide valuable insights and help you gauge your level of enthusiasm and fulfillment in different work environments. It may also open doors to unexpected career paths and help you develop new skills.

Seek Guidance and Support: Don’t be afraid to seek guidance and support throughout your career exploration journey. Reach out to career counselors, mentors, or professionals in fields you admire. They can provide guidance, advice, and insights based on their own experiences. Additionally, consider engaging in career assessment tools or workshops that can help you gain a deeper understanding of your personality traits, values, and work preferences. Surround yourself with a supportive network of friends and family who can provide encouragement and objective perspectives.
Embrace Growth and Adaptability: Keep in mind that career paths are rarely linear, and it’s okay to change direction as you evolve and grow. Embrace a mindset of growth and adaptability, knowing that your passions and interests may shift over time. Be open to new opportunities and be willing to take calculated risks. Remember that finding your true career calling is a journey, and it’s okay to explore different paths before finding the one that resonates most deeply with you.
